- 1). Press "Ctrl" "Shift" and "Esc" to open the Task Manager window.
- 2). Click the "Processes" tab and scroll to the name of your security software. Click the "End Process" button to stop the software from running.
- 3). Click "Start," "Control Panel," then click the "Programs and Features" link to open a list of software programs on your computer.
- 4). Click the file name of the security software in the window that appears, and click "Uninstall." Click "Yes" in the prompt that appears to disable the security software and remove it from your computer.
- 5). Restart your computer once the uninstall is complete to permanently disable the software, and remove the files from your hard drive.
